Day 1: Lao Cai - Can Cau - Bac Ha (B/L/D) |
Day 1: Lao Cai - Can Cau - Bac Ha (B/L/D)
In the early morning, arrive in Lao Cai. We will enjoy a breakfast before start a 80-km departure through the beautiful Bac Ha mountains to Can Cau. Can Cau is an every-Sunday-astonishing market situated just below the Chinese border. The colourful and vibrant market is the good chance for you to see many ethnic minorities such as the Flower H’mong, Nung, Phu, La or even some Chinese people who come from the across border. The numerous kinds of goods including from fabrics to livestock sold here makes the scenery so vivid.
 
Glide downhill back to Bac Ha where you check in at home stay or hotel. Enjoy a lunch to fill up energy and we will visit around Bac Ha and Ban Pho villages, enjoy the immense landscape of plum orchards and rice fields and even comprehend about the local agriculture and local lifestyle.
 
Round off the day, you can experience a cooking class to learn how to make some local foods at home stay. (Accomodation at stilt house or hotel).
Day 2: Bac Ha - Trung Do - Lao Cai station (B/L/D) |
Day 2: Bac Ha - Trung Do - Lao Cai station (B/L/D)
After breakfast, be sure that your camera is ready for the famous Bac Ha market, the dreaming place to any photograph hunter. The sights, sounds and smells in this busy market surely will be unforgettable and able to make your photos more fantastic. Don’t forget to sample the delicious taste of local corn wine, then we will cycle through town to visit the well-known H’mong King’s house, a remarkable monument designed in the French colonial and Chinese architecture. Built in 1920, this monument deserves to be the proud of the region.
 
After lunch and a short rest, check out your hotel and we will riding out of town, down to the mountain road and then drive back to Lao Cai. Following your freshen up, we will enjoy a dinner before transferring to the Lao Cai station for night train back to Hanoi. Finish the adventure when our guide say goodbye to you on the train.

Money Exchange:
The official currency of Thailand is the Baht (THB).
The official currency of Cambodia is the Riel (KHR). 
Unofficially however, US currency (US$) runs the country and is the currency you should bring, mostly in cash - notes should be 2006 series onwards. Clean bills in small denominations are most useful. Notes should be 2006 series onwards. Torn, dirty or old notes, as well as the $2US note will be refused in most businesses. ATMs are available in Phnom Penh, Sihanoukville and Siem Reap and also dispense in both KHR and US$. 
The official currency of Vietnam is Dong (VND).
Some establishments will accept US currency (USD), but usually only for large purchases and in some restaurants and hotels that cater to tourists. It's not possible to exchange Vietnamese Dong outside the country, so convert or spend all your Dong before leaving.
The most convenient and cheapest way to obtain local currency in is via an Automated Teller Machine (ATM). ATMs are now available in most towns and visa cash advances are available in major banks. The use of credit cards is restricted, mainly to major hotels. Foreign currency notes that are old, torn or faded can be very difficult to exchange; clean bills in small denominations are most useful. Traveller's cheques are unacceptable to change. 
 
Tipping:
If you're happy with the services provided a tip - though not compulsory - is appropriate. While it may not be customary to you, it's of great significance to the people who will take care of you during your travels, inspires excellent service, and is an entrenched feature of the tourism industry across many Asia destinations. Although can be difficult to source we advise you to carry small notes of local currency each day to make tipping easier. Please note we recommend that any tips are given directly to the intended recipient by a member of your group as our group leaders are prohibited from collecting cash for tips.
The following amounts are per person suggestions based on local considerations and feedback from our past travelers:
Restaurants: Local markets and basic restaurants - round your bill up to the nearest US$1. More up-market restaurants we suggest 10% to 15% of your bill.
Local guides: Throughout your trip you may at times have a local guide in addition to your tour leader. We suggest US$2-US$3 per day for local guides.
Drivers: You may have a range of drivers on your trip. Some may be with you for a short journey while others may be with you for several days. We would suggest a higher tip for those more involved with the group, however we suggest US$1-US$2 per day for drivers.
Please don't tip with coins, very small denomination notes, or dirty and ripped notes. This is regarded culturally as an insult.
